Philip Asiodu Institute has launched its inaugural essay competition for secondary school students.

The institute, in a statement, disclosed that the competition, themed: ‘Encouraging Patriotism and Nurturing Nigerian Leaders of Tomorrow’, is open to secondary school students nationwide.

The competition aims at identifying and encouraging young talents, and providing the winners with valuable mentorship and support to make significant impact on the future of Nigeria.

A representative of the competition team, ‘Yemi Adeyemi-Enilari, said those interested in participating in the competition should visit the institute’s website.

He disclosed that the essay competition started on Thursday, with topics revolving around the themes of patriotism, unity, diligence, integrity and discipline.

It was revealed that the winners of the competition will go home with prizes.

“These prizes will not only empower the winners themselves but also contribute to the development of their respective schools.”

Additionally, the best essays from the competition will be published on the official website of the Philip Asiodu Institute, providing a platform for wider exposure and shared learning,” Adeyemi-Enilari said.
